[Freeipa-devel] [PATCH] 0045-47: webui: Sub-CAs

Pavel Vomacka pvomacka at redhat.com
Tue Jun 14 08:17:17 UTC 2016



On 06/14/2016 06:42 AM, Fraser Tweedale wrote:
> On Mon, Jun 13, 2016 at 07:48:58PM +0200, Pavel Vomacka wrote:
>>
>> On 06/13/2016 06:55 AM, Fraser Tweedale wrote:
>>> On Fri, Jun 10, 2016 at 04:34:33PM +0200, Pavel Vomacka wrote:
>>>> Hello,
>>>>
>>>> please review these new patches which add WebUI for Sub-CAs.
>>>>
>>>> https://fedorahosted.org/freeipa/ticket/5939
>>>>
>>> Hi Pavel, I have reviewed the functionality of the patches.
>>> Functionality is good - a few minor comments below.
>> Hello, thank you for review.
>>> Patch 45:
>>>
>>> 1) In the main `Certificate Authorities' table, `Subject DN' is
>>> showing the DN of the IPA object, instead of the Subject DN.
>> Fixed.
>>> 2) In the `Certificate Authorities' detail table, there is an
>>> unlabelled row showing the DN of the IPA object.  IMO we do not need
>>> to show this value at all.
>> The field removed.
>>> Patch 46:
>>>
>>> 3) I see a FIXME in certificate.js.  The behaviour (default to IPA
>>> CA / 'ipa') is OK.  Alternatively, you could allow the user to not
>>> specify a CA (this will allow the default - currently 'ipa' - to be
>>> controlled by server).
>> FIXME comment removed.
>>> Patch 47:
>>>
>>> 4) For backwards compatibility, a CA ACL without any specified CAs
>>> (and not cacat=all) implies the 'ipa' CA.  It would be good to
>>> indicate this in the UI somehow, or include a notice to explain.
>> I added tooltip next to the checkbox on adder dialog and also note above the
>> table with CAs in CA ACL details view.
>>
> The message has a small typo: "specificed" should be "specified"
> (the typo occurrs in both places).
>
> Once this is fixed, ACK.
Updated patches attached.

--
Pavel^3 Vomacka
-------------- next part --------------
A non-text attachment was scrubbed...
Name: freeipa-pvomacka-0045-2-Add-new-webui-plugin-ca.patch
Type: text/x-patch
Size: 4050 bytes
Desc: not available
URL: <http://listman.redhat.com/archives/freeipa-devel/attachments/20160614/325816ed/attachment.bin>
-------------- next part --------------
A non-text attachment was scrubbed...
Name: freeipa-pvomacka-0046-2-Extend-certificate-entity-page.patch
Type: text/x-patch
Size: 7772 bytes
Desc: not available
URL: <http://listman.redhat.com/archives/freeipa-devel/attachments/20160614/325816ed/attachment-0001.bin>
-------------- next part --------------
A non-text attachment was scrubbed...
Name: freeipa-pvomacka-0047-3-Extend-caacl-entity.patch
Type: text/x-patch
Size: 8426 bytes
Desc: not available
URL: <http://listman.redhat.com/archives/freeipa-devel/attachments/20160614/325816ed/attachment-0002.bin>


More information about the Freeipa-devel mailing list